Even if there was no disabling of an account after so many unsuccessful login attempts, there's the issue of network latency. Even if this GPU monster could check billions of combinations a second, good luck with hitting that remote system at that rate. You'd probably end up with under 100 per second, maybe not even close to that. Usually I set my servers up to hold the server response, on a false password, for about 4 seconds, so they can't use more than 15 passwords a minute or 21600 passwords a day. And with that many false login attempts i wil be alerted |

It would be ok if the login in question was on a PC or HDD that someone had it on hand and could slam at it while it was connected to the beast. Aye on a standalone password protected document of some sort this will probably be great. For those of us with 12+ character passwords using both cases, numbers, and special characters, this isn't really a threat to security when it's remote from out machine across a normal internet connection. Especially if you have your remote access services disabled. |
